About the Hiring Company

Our client is a comprehensive network of medical equipment companies with over 670 locations in 47 states. They offer a wide range of tailored products and services, including respiratory, sleep, and diabetes health, to empower patients to live their best lives at home outside of a hospital setting.

About the Role

The Senior Vice President, Sleep & Respiratory Sales, will lead and drive revenue growth for all Sleep & Respiratory sales initiatives. This key role involves developing sales strategy, managing high-performing teams, and collaborating with operations to efficiently convert referrals into billable orders at scale. The position oversees healthcare providers, hospitals/health systems, and enterprise sales channels.
